SUMMARY
Situated in a popular and sought after residential area within close proximity to Lincoln City Centre is this well appointed and spacious four bedroom end-terrace property benefiting from modern kitchen and shower suites, well proportioned reception rooms and a low maintenance enclosed rear garden.


DESCRIPTION
Situated in a popular and sought after residential area within close proximity to Lincoln City Centre is this well appointed and spacious four bedroom end-terrace property benefiting from modern kitchen and shower suites, well proportioned reception rooms, a low maintenance enclosed rear garden and a wide range of local amenities, schooling and transport links. Internally the accommodation briefly comprises; Entrance Hall, Lounge, Dining Room, Kitchen, Shower Room and Four Bedrooms over two floors with the potential for an En-suite to the Master. EARLY AND INTERNAL VIEWING IS HIGHLY ADVISED TO FULLY APPRECIATE THE SPACE AND STANDARD OF ACCOMMODATION BEING OFFERED TO THE MARKET.

Entrance Hall 
With uPVC double glazed front entrance door, wall mounted panel radiator and access to the further ground floor accommodation.

Lounge 16' 2" into bay x 11' 3" max ( 4.93m into bay x 3.43m max )
Having a uPVC double glazed box bay window to the front aspect, wall mounted panel radiator, coving and feature electric fire with decorative surround, back and hearth.

Dining Room 16' 4" into alcove x 14' 7" ( 4.98m into alcove x 4.45m )
Having uPVC double glazed patio doors to the rear aspect leading out to the garden, stairs rising to the first floor, dado rail, coving, wall lights, wall mounted panel radiator, understairs cupboard and door into the Lounge. Opening into:-

Kitchen 16' 11" x 6' 10" ( 5.16m x 2.08m )
Being fitted with a range of base and eye level units with work surfaces incorporating a stainless steel sink and space and plumbing for various appliances including a fridge freezer and range style cooker with extractor above; complete with tiled splashbacks, breakfast bar, coving, uPVC double glazed window to the side aspect and door leading into:-

Shower Room 
Being fitted with a low level WC, wash hand basin and a double shower cubicle; complete with fully tiled walls and flooring, an obscure uPVC double glazed window to the side aspect, extractor fan and a heated towel rail.

First Floor Landing 
Having access to two bedrooms, wall mounted panel radiator and stairs rising to the further two bedrooms.

Bedroom One 12' 11" x 9' 11" ( 3.94m x 3.02m )
Having a uPVC double glazed window to the rear aspect, wall mounted panel radiator, walk-in wardrobe and door leading into:-

Potential En-suite 
Having all pipe work installed to be converted into an en-suite.

Bedroom Two 15' 1" into alcove x 10' 1" ( 4.60m into alcove x 3.07m )
Having a uPVC double glazed window to the front aspect and a wall mounted panel radiator.

Second Floor Landing 
Giving access to the two remaining bedrooms.

Bedroom Three 13' 7" x 9' 9" ( 4.14m x 2.97m )
Having a uPVC double glazed window to the front aspect, wall mounted panel radiator and storage into the eaves.

Bedroom Four 13' 7" x 9' ( 4.14m x 2.74m )
Having a uPVC double glazed window to the rear aspect, wall mounted panel radiator and storage into the eaves.

Outside 
The rear garden is low maintenance being laid to patio, decked and gravelled areas with hardstanding for a garden shed; all of which is fully enclosed to perimeters by wall and timber fencing.
